Disclaimer: I work for Google.  Any and all opinions expressed or interpreted below are mine own and not that of my employer. I’ve built dozens webapps in the past 10 years (thats right, i was writing web apps at 13) using all sorts of tools.  It started with raw HTML and spaghetti code perl.  Then [...]